Droom OBV won’t let you become a ‘bakra’
MUMBAI: Three animated videos continue Droom’s sustained media blitz to establish OBV as the de-facto industry standard for used vehicle pricing.
Buying or selling a pre-owned vehicle can be a big hassle, especially when it comes to the pricing. But, what if consumers could get a fair price of a vehicle within 10 seconds, right at their fingertips?
This unique proposition offered by Orange Book Value (OBV), Droom’s proprietary algorithmic pricing engine, is what the recently-launched TVC campaign highlights. With three quirky animated videos, the latest TVCs from Droom underline why OBV is the perfect tool that empowers consumers and helps them in ascertaining the fair market value of any used vehicle within seconds. The importance of OBV as a benchmark price when buying or selling used vehicles is driven home with the brand’s sharp tagline, ‘Resale ka MRP’. This ease of usage and trust factor has driven great user traction, and has seen nearly 90 million pricing queries generated through OBV’s web and mobile platforms till date.
Droom founder & CEO Sandeep Aggarwal said said, “These ads highlight how OBV empowers consumers when making used vehicle transactions. By generating the fair market value of any used vehicle within 10 seconds, OBV ensures that no one can make a fool, or ‘bakra’, out of consumers, and helps in ending the debate on ‘used gaadi’ rates!”
The three videos feature an animated lion which explains to viewers how OBV works, what its value proposition is, and why users should choose OBV to get an unbiased, independent and data-driven price for pre-owned vehicles. With the videos, already having received a great viewer reception online, the TVC campaign will allow Droom to reach out to even more consumers and educate them on the benefits of OBV. The company is spending Rs 25 crore on the marketing to reach users.
Team Contract Advertising stated, “OBV makes valuation of used cars so simple, quick and objective that a deal can be reached within seconds. So, nobody can make a ‘bakra’ out of you. That’s the simple idea behind this campaign.”

Indian Silk House Agencies launches ‘Shubho Smriti’ PoilaBoishakh campaign
Brand celebrates Bengali New Year with stories of 100 women and their saree memories.
MUMBAI: Indian Silk House Agencies has woven a beautiful new story for PoilaBoishakh, one stitched together with memories, emotions, and the timeless elegance of a saree. The leading saree retailer has unveiled ‘Shubho Smriti’, a digital-first campaign that brings together the voices of 100 women sharing their personal celebrations of the Bengali New Year. The campaign highlights how the saree remains an essential thread in these evolving traditions, from daughters gifting their mothers after years of quiet sacrifice to sarees passed down through generations carrying decades of love.
Indian Silk House Agencies CEO Darshan Dudhoria said, “What gives any tradition its relevance over time are the memories people attach to it. For over five decades, we have been closely connected to this cultural fabric. This campaign came from a simple intent to listen to these stories of our customers and bring them together.”
To mark the occasion, the brand has launched a dedicated PoilaBoishakh collection featuring handwoven textiles such as Matka silk and Jamdani, along with classic reds and whites, softer seasonal hues, and brighter options. The collection starts at ₹999 and is now available online and in stores across Eastern India.
